Q2 2026 earnings summary

29 Jul, 2026

Executive summary

  • Total revenue for Q2 2026 increased 5.5% year-over-year to $93.5 million, driven by record 6,200 Glo Fiber net additions and strong expansion in Glo Fiber and Commercial Fiber segments.

  • Adjusted EBITDA rose 12.9% year-over-year to $32.0 million, with margin improving to 34%.

  • Net loss narrowed to $7.7 million from $9.0 million in Q2 2025.

  • Fiber revenue grew 21.4% year-over-year, now representing 51% of consolidated revenue.

  • Glo Fiber Expansion Markets revenue surged 32.8% year-over-year, offsetting declines in Incumbent Broadband and RLEC revenues.

Financial highlights

  • Glo Fiber Expansion Markets revenue grew $6.5 million or 32.8% year-over-year, driven by a 32.1% increase in data RGUs.

  • Commercial Fiber revenue increased $1.9 million or 9.8% year-over-year.

  • Adjusted EBITDA margin improved by 200 basis points to 34% year-over-year.

  • Incumbent Broadband Markets revenue declined $2.6 million (6.0%) due to lower video and data ARPU.

  • Net loss per share for Q2 was $0.17.

Outlook and guidance

  • 2026 revenue guidance: $370–$377 million, up from $358 million in 2025.

  • 2026 Adjusted EBITDA guidance: $131–$136 million, up from $119 million in 2025.

  • 2026 capital expenditures (net of grants) expected at $220–$250 million, down from $296 million in 2025.

  • Positive free cash flow projected for 2027 and beyond, supported by EBITDA growth and lower capital intensity.

  • Guidance excludes potential impacts from tariffs, chip shortages, and geopolitical conflicts.
